WebIn federal court, the jury decides the verdict. It’s the judge’s job to act as referee, ruling on issues of law before and during the trial. Federal judges keep up to date on many laws and rules such as: Federal Laws. Case Law. Varying State Law. Federal Rules. Examples. The U.S. Constitution and Amendments. A person who is unhappy with a judge's final ruling can also appeal the decision to a higher court.
